> I have a Spark job and I just want to stop it on some condition. Once the
> condition is met, I am calling JavaStreamingContext.stop(), but it just
> hangs. Does not move on to the next line, which is just a debug line. I
> expect it to come out.
>
> I already tried different variants of stop, that is, passing true to stop
> the spark context, etc. but nothing is working out.
>
> Here's the sample code:
>
>             LOGGER.debug("Stop? {}", stop);
>             if (stop) {
>                 jssc.stop(false, true);
>                 LOGGER.debug("STOPPED!");
>             }
>
> I am using Spark 1.5.2. Any help / pointers would be appreciated.
